I found this book browsing and the title, cover and information I could read on the dust jacket intrigued me. This has to be one of my favorite stories I have ever read- a true story of a family from Detroit working in Africa. She volunteers at an orphanage and falls in love with one of the kids. It tells of the many problems she encounters trying to adopt as well as the conditions of the orphanage and the massive amount of deaths. Truly, a very touching story.
